Should I look at my Sun Sign only?
The general rule of thumb when reading horoscopes is to check for both your Sun Sign and Rising Sign (or Ascendant), because both have huge influences on our personality.
- Your Sun Sign is your self-expression and identity (what your friends know you as).
- Your Rising Sign is your aura and social persona (people’s first impression of you).

Aries: Gryffindor
Brave, risk-taking leaders.
No surprises here. Aries run towards danger, and are usually competitive, athletic and a little combative (this just screams Quidditch captain). Underneath their brashness and short tempers, though, they have hearts of gold and thrive when they’re able to follow their instincts as leaders. Aries always have the best intentions are are willing to forgive and forget. Their energy is quintessential warrior-hero vibes.
Taurus: Hufflepuff
Chill, reliable, earthy.
Tauruses love stability and comfort, which is why they fit perfectly in with their loyal, friendly and no-nonsense wizards in Hufflepuff. Don’t confuse their steadfastness as weakness though, because these Taurean bulls are determined. They also have a knack for anything to do with plants, so you’ll likely find them in the Herbology classroom with Professor Sprout (the Head of Hufflepuff, btw). Need more proof? Huffelpuff’s dorm is underground and literally next to the school kitchens, and Tauruses are known as being the foodies of the zodiac.
Gemini: Slytherin
Adaptable, intelligent, curious.
Geminis get a reputation for being two-faced or deceitful (and sure, there are probably some who feel the pull of dark wizardry), but their quick minds and even quicker wits are also used for good. Slytherins are cunning and ambitious, which aren’t always bad qualities when used with the right intentions. Geminis are great communicators and possess a natural friendly charm. They’re curious to a fault; which is ultimately how Tom Riddle started down his path of Horcruxes, right?

Cancer: Hufflepuff
Intuitive, emotionally intelligent, nurturing.
Where else would you find a Cancer than snuggled down in the Hufflepuff Common Room, listening to their classmates’ troubles and supporting their friends? Cancers have mama bear energy, and they are the most loyal, caring and compassionate people you’ll meet. But don’t get me wrong, Cancers have a fiercely protective side. Never underestimate a Hufflepuff. Also, great thing the Hufflepuff dorm is right next to the kitchen, because Cancers love comfort food.
Leo: Gryffindor
Big-hearted, brave, playful.
This one’s just too easy, the Lion being the Gryffindor signet. While Aries run towards danger, Leos run towards drama. They’re confident, charismatic leaders with big hearts and buckets of optimism. Gryffindors tend to assume they’re the House and love being the centre of attention, which is true for Leos too. But we love them for it. Harry Potter is also a Leo – ahem, main character energy.
Virgo: Ravenclaw
Analytical, helpful, honest.
You’ll always want a Virgo in your corner, because they’re some of the most trustworthy, practical and observant people around. They often are logical when others are over-emotional, which makes them the overachievers of Hogwarts. They’re far from cold though; Virgos are incredible listeners, unbelievably patient and will always drop everything to help out their friends. The Ravenclaw dorm is high up in a tower (exactly where observant Virgo wants to be) and the only way to get in is to be clever enough to solve a riddle asked by the door knocker. Virgos love this shit.

Libra: Hufflepuff
Peaceful, charming, fair.
Libras value their social relationships above all, and there’s no more friendship-oriented House than Hufflepuff. They also love all things aesthetic, romantic and artistic (and personally I think the Hufflepuff dorm is the most beautiful). They’re naturally drawn to justice and mediation, and can tend to be a little people-pleasing. But luckily, they’re safe amongst the other peaceful easygoing Hufflepuffs who won’t try to take advantage of them.
Scorpio: Slytherin
Magnetic, driven, strategic.
Surprise, surprise. Scorpios are an intuitive, perceptive bunch in touch with their inner serpent, and can probably most definitely speak in Parseltongue. Although they get a bad rap for being drawn to darkness, Scorpios (and Slytherins) actually understand that delving deep into the shadows, something most people avoid, is where we heal, grow and create more light. While initimidating, they’re actually super empathetic and can even be mindreaders.
Sagittarius: Gryffindor
Optimistic, passionate, carefree.
Another fire sign you say, hmm? Must be…a Gryffindor! Sagittarians are adventurous, free-spirited and spontaneous, with a dose of blatant honesty that sometimes gets them in trouble. They’re also wise and scholarly, so you’re just as likely to find them in the library as you are in the Forbidden Forest trying to find a centaur (that’s the Sagittarius symbol, after all). These Gryffindors are inspirational leaders, and crave independence and freedom more than anything.

Capricorn: Slytherin
Responsible, serious, driven.
Capricorns, just like Slytherins, are one of the most commanding, committed and ambitious signs. Their work ethic is unparalleled, with a single-minded focus on achieving their goals and discipline that is envied by the other Houses. While they can appear closed off and cold, don’t be fooled; Capricorns are incredibly reliable and loyal. Just don’t expect them to entertain your dumb plans to chase a troll into the dungeons, because they’ve got places to go.
Aquarius: Ravenclaw
Objective, unconventional, independent.
The inventors and visionaries of the zodiac, Aquarius are definitely not afraid to do things differently and own what sets them apart. They love talking about intellectual topics and fiddling around with technology; the Time Turner was definitely invented by an Aquarius Ravenclaw. Whilst they come off quirky and aloof (like the Ravenclaw Aquarius icon, Luna Lovegood), Aquarians are super friendly and treat everyone equally so they’re well-liked by everyone.
Pisces: Ravenclaw
Empathetic, contemplative, imaginative.
Up in the astronomy tower is exactly where you’ll find a Pisces, and also most Ravenclaws. These mystics are extremely intuitive, spiritual and creative, so Divination is their realm of magic. Pisceans are also the most compassionate and selfless people you’ll meet, which can cause them to be way too loose with their boundaries or always see the best in people. With their rose-coloured glasses (think Professor Trelawney), Pisces love to escape to other realms or get lost in the clouds.
